Section 5.14: Headings

Headings create a structural framework for the document, allowing users to navigate quickly between sections and gain an overview of the content by reviewing the headings.

Headings are marked using <H1>to <H6> tags, offering six levels of hierarchy similar to those in MS Word. Additionally, a general heading tag, <H>, is also available.

If you use the Reading Order Tool,

  1. Activate the Reading Order Tool.

  2. Draw a box around the heading.

  3. Choose the button that matches the desired heading level (1 to 6).

    A heading is highlighted with a pink border and the reading order tool is open. The 6 heading buttons are highlighted with a black border.
